A transformed equation is a new equation derived from an original equation by applying mathematical operations such as addition, subtraction, multiplication, or division. These transformations help simplify or manipulate the equation to solve for a specific variable or to represent it in a different form.

Energy is transformed from one form to another. According to the law of conservation of energy, energy cannot be created or destroyed, only transformed from one form to another. For example, potential energy can be transformed into kinetic energy.
Energy can be transformed or changed into different forms but cannot be destroyed, according to the Law of Conservation of Energy.
Electrical energy is transformed into light energy in a light bulb. Chemical energy is transformed into mechanical energy in an engine. Solar energy is transformed into electrical energy in a solar panel. Wind energy is transformed into electrical energy in a wind turbine. Food energy is transformed into thermal energy by the body to maintain body temperature.

Yes. Quite often, if you don't, you'll lose solutions. That is, the transformed equation - after taking square roots - will have less solutions than the original equation.
The Darboux transformation is a method used to generate new solutions of a given nonlinear Schrodinger equation by manipulating the scattering data of the original equation. It provides a way to construct exact soliton solutions from known solutions. The process involves creating a link between the spectral properties of the original equation and the transformed equation.
